">About the Role
">The Industry Manager provides leadership and direction to Product Portfolio Managers for designated industries. Activities include giving business unit direction on industry trends, planning and executing growth strategies, managing and expanding product lines and supplier relationships.
">This role manages profit and loss for a global portfolio of product lines. We define and refine ChemPoint marketing and sales processes in collaboration with Marketing to meet and exceed supplier, customer, and internal goals.
">Your Key Responsibilities
">- ">
- Maintain effective relationships with assigned vendors and act as a liaison for vendor/field relations. ">
- Stay abreast of product trends and industry developments, pursuing new products/vendors to ensure the most effective product/vendor mix. ">
- Recommend new/modified strategies based on external market analysis, financial analysis, and marketing objectives. ">
- Initiate and manage national incentive programs with key vendors and industry managers, responsible for their implementation. ">
- Monitor and analyze product sales and profitability, comparing and assuring compliance with established goals. ">
- Generate industry reports, make recommendations for corrective action, and actively assist in their implementation. ">
- Maintain close communications with Marketing, as well as Sales and Operations within the organization. ">
- Conduct in-house supplier updates to enhance industry performance as required. ">
- Conduct market research projects to assist regions in developing industry plans. ">
- Understand and practice the guiding principles. ">
- Perform other related duties as required or requested. ">
